Mental Health Counselor: Community Based (QMHP-C)

Intensive In-home

EMS of Virginia is seeking a Qualified Mental Health Professional (QMHP) to provide Intensive In-home Services on a Full-time basis in the greater Richmond area (city of Richmond, Henrico, Chesterfield, Petersburg, Hanover, and surrounding areas). You must be registered with the Department of Health Professions as a QMHP-C in order to be eligible for this position. Duties include (but are not limited to):

  • Seeing clients in the community such as the client's home
  • Providing 1-1 mental health counseling related to goals
  • Working with family systems
  • Case Management to ensure client's basic needs are met
  • Providing individual and family counseling to children and adolescents
  • Completing individualized services plans
  • Completing quarterly reports
  • Completing progress notes for each session with a client
  • Providing information for authorization of services
  • Meeting regularly for supervision
  • Attendance at team meetings
  • Maintaining ongoing communication with your Clinical Supervisor
